What can be done with a masters in International Business and a bachelors in Japanese?

Posted on August 23rd, 2010 by admin

I am focusing on a five year business program, but I need to choose a language to go with it. I feel that Japanese would be great because of all the economic relations we have with Japan.

Personally, I’d suggest Japanese, but I’m biased. I’m Majoring in Japanese with a minor in business. To learn enough Japanese in order for it to be useful in business would require at least three, maybe four years plus time speaking it naturally to other people. Same with Chinese. Though the business opportunities in both those countries are great. I love Japanese, but it can be tough. If you think you can handle both, go for it. Otherwise, a European language wouldn’t require learning a new writing system.

I’d like to know if my japanese brother-in-law who owns a business can bring me to Japan to work for him? How?

Posted on April 1st, 2010 by admin

Additional Infos:
I’ve been to Japan thru Visiting Relative Visa for 3 times already
I’m a professional
And I studied Basic Japanese Language
Additional Infos:
I’ve been to Japan thru Visiting Relative Visa for 3 times already
I’m a professional & have an IT related degree
And I studied Basic Japanese Language
His business is a pharmaceutica l/ drugstore

His business will need to be of a certain size and capital to be able to sponsor work visas for foreign employees. The best way is for HIM to go to Immigration Office and ask immigration officials directly in Japanese abut proper business licenses and immigration requirements.

Yahoo boards is not the place to be seeking legal advice.
